About Moonstone Farm

Moonstone Farm is located in Western Washington near the Puget Sound. We provide a lifelong home for all the animals in our care.

Moonstone Farm Sanctuary was founded as an extension of our lifelong commitment to veganism and nonviolence.

We believe that every animal deserves safety and comfort, and a life free from exploitation, abuse, and murder. Our animals are family, and came from a variety of circumstances including neglect, abuse, and exploitation by the meat and dairy industries.

Dahlia, pictured at left, was scheduled for slaughter as an eight year old dairy cow. She's already twice as old as the average cow in the United States, as most are butchered by age four. She will live out her full natural life at Moonstone Farm Sanctuary—perhaps as much as 20 more years.
